US official: Up to 10 Russian generals killed in war against Ukraine.

According to Scott Berrier, head of the U.S. defense intelligence agency, after two and a half months of the war, the death toll among Russia's top military leadership ranges from 8 to 10 people. This figure far exceeds the number of U.S. generals who have died in two decades of conflict in Afghanistan.
